What is Collarblind?
1.
What Michael Scott from NBC's The Office says when he compares the people in the warehouse to the people who work upstairs in the office. He at first refers to the warehouse people as blue collared and the office people as white collared. By this he means the color of the collars on their shirts for those of you who can't tell the difference.
Michael Scott: "When i look around this room, I do not see blue collars or white collars... THAT is because i am "collarblind".
